Metamorphosis is primarily triggered by hormonal changes in an organism, which can be influenced by environmental factors such as temperature, light, and food availability. In insects, for instance, the release of hormones like ecdysone initiates the transition from larval stages to pupae and eventually to adult forms. In amphibians, thyroid hormones play a crucial role in triggering the transformation from tadpoles to frogs. These hormonal signals coordinate the complex physiological and morphological changes necessary for metamorphosis.
